Two Pairs Named to All-Conference First Team As Eight Chosen As All-Big West
5/2/2024 10:05:00 AM | Women's Beach Volleyball
Malia Gementera, Taylor Hagenah, Julia Westby and Savannah Standage all earned First Team.
LONG BEACH, Calif.— Long Beach State saw their tremendous season recognized with four pairs being named All-Big West. For three consecutive seasons, The Beach has had four pairs earn Conference awards. The Big West announced the winners on Thursday.
Recently named First Team All-Americans, Malia Gementera and Taylor Hagenah were once again named to the All-Big West First Team for their efforts at the first flight. They only dropped one match during the conference championship to add to their impressive 26-9 record for the season.
Julia Westby and Savannah Standage were also named to the All-Big West First Team because of their stunning conference record. Playing exclusively at the second flight, the duo has not dropped a single set in conference all year. They took down Cal Poly at the Big West Challenge in March and did it again but this time, to be the dual clinching point that advanced the Beach to the Big West final.
The third flight duo of Mo Gibson and Natalie Glenn were given the All-Big West Second Team honor with an 18-6 record for the season. They were the only duo to win a match against Hawai'i on the first day of the Big West Championship along with other top wins.
The pair of Christine Deroos and Megan Widener were given All-Big West Honorable Mentions. The duo dominated earlier in the season with a 15 win-streak among their 21 wins.
Long Beach State Beach Volleyball has advanced to the postseason for the sixth time in program history, and will open their third appearance in the NCAA Championship against Cal on Friday, May 3.
